|
|
@@ -7,6 +7,7 @@ import com.ruoyi.common.core.web.controller.BaseController;
|
|
|
import com.ruoyi.common.core.web.domain.AjaxResult;
|
|
|
import com.ruoyi.common.security.annotation.InnerAuth;
|
|
|
import com.ruoyi.logistics.config.SFExpressConfig;
|
|
|
+import com.ruoyi.logistics.constant.SysConfigConstants;
|
|
|
import com.ruoyi.logistics.service.IMonthQRCodeTaskService;
|
|
|
import com.ruoyi.logistics.service.LogisticsOrderService;
|
|
|
import com.ruoyi.system.service.ISysConfigService;
|
|
|
@@ -68,9 +69,13 @@ public class MonthQRCodeController extends BaseController {
|
|
|
* @return
|
|
|
*/
|
|
|
@GetMapping("/getMonthCard")
|
|
|
- public AjaxResult getMonthCard(@RequestParam("source") Integer source) {
|
|
|
+ public AjaxResult getMonthCard(@RequestParam("source") Integer source, @RequestParam("type") Integer type) {
|
|
|
if (source == 1) {
|
|
|
- return success(configService.selectConfigByKey("jd.logistics.customercode"));
|
|
|
+ if (type == 1) {
|
|
|
+ return success(configService.selectConfigByKey(SysConfigConstants.JD_LOGISTICS_CUSTOMERCODE));
|
|
|
+ } else if (type == 2) {
|
|
|
+ return success(configService.selectConfigByKey(SysConfigConstants.JD_LOGISTICS_BUSINESSUNITCODE));
|
|
|
+ }
|
|
|
}
|
|
|
return success(sfExpressConfig.getMonthlyCord());
|
|
|
}
|